Output d6e5d20c94fc4f9b6b4bcfaa5bac8b8f419d30cc2e281e054a6a344e1497d712:1

value
6942896953216
script pubkey
OP_0 OP_PUSHBYTES_20 c94b650f8289993e617896492c942b3b50d3d302
address
tb1qe99k2ruz3xvnuctcjeyje9pt8dgd85czeme6kz
transaction
d6e5d20c94fc4f9b6b4bcfaa5bac8b8f419d30cc2e281e054a6a344e1497d712
confirmations
189121
spent
true